Whiskey: Bad Sweater
4 year-old Bourbon spiked with our favorite holiday spices –cinnamon, nutmeg, clove, cacao nibs and vanilla bean.
Size: 750mL
Proof: 80 (40% ABV)
Origin: United States
Distillery: Savage & Cooke Distillery
The blend of spices is steeped in the Bourbon to extract maximum flavor and integration. Inviting and undoubtedly festive, this will be your new favorite accompaniment to holiday merrymaking. Distillery Information
The Savage & Cooke distillery, owned by Napa Valley winemaker Dave Phinney, is located on historic Mare Island and opened in 2018. The decision to locate the distillery on Mare Island was due to its fascinating history as a naval shipyard, the plethora of space, stunning brownstone buildings and its proximity to both the Napa Valley and San Francisco. Savage & Cooke distills, ages, finishes and bottles a range of brown spirits including Bourbon, Whiskey and Rye.
